Integration of fine grinding and H2SO4 leach for the ...

As shown in Table 1, the fine-grinding process leads to the reduction of Cu in the concentrate from 41.7 wt% at 0 min to 34.4 wt% at 120 min, revealing that Cu dissolution is proportional to the fine grinding time.Similarly, S in the copper concentrate declined from 24.2 wt% at 0 min to 18.2 wt% at 120 min due to the formation of soluble sulphate anions.

Detrimental effect of calcium on grinding performance of a ...

The negative effect of Ca 2+ ions on grinding performance may be mitigated by adding sulfate ions, resulting in the formation of CaSO 4 which has similar solubility product as Ca(OH) 2; it should be noted that CaSO 4 does not affect pH of a solution while the opposite is true in the case of Ca(OH) 2.

Calcium Sulphate - an overview | ScienceDirect Topics

The hydrous form of calcium sulfate, Terra Alba, contains about 20% water of crystallization. It is processed by fine grinding and air-separation to a selected, white, high purity gypsum. The anhydrous gypsum form is obtained by the same process, the addition of a calcination step in which water is almost entirely removed (only about 0.3% remains).

Application Note Titanium Dioxide - Sulfate Process

The Sulfate & Chloride Processes There are two processes used to leach titanium from ore: the chloride process and the sulfate process. The chloride process uses chlorine gas (Cl 2) and coke (C+) at elevated temperature to create titanium tetrachloride (TiCl 4). Portland Cement Manufacturing Process In Cement Plant | AGICO

Magnesia & Calcium Sulfate: magnesium oxide exists in cement with very weak content. Once the content exceeds the upper limit, it will affect the performance of cement. The calcium sulfate is mainly from gypsum and has an effect of slowing down the solidification speed. In cement plant, gypsum is usually added in the clinker grinding process.
